On the Saturday, towards five o'clock, he came back once more, still hoping for better luck.
He left his house on foot.

The evening was chill and gray, and a heavy leaden twilight was settling over the city.

The lamps were already lighted round the fountain in the Piazza Barberini like pale tapers round a funeral bier, and the Triton, whether being under repair or for some other reason, had ceased to spout water.

Down the sloping roadway came a line of carts drawn by two or three horses harnessed in single file, and bands of workmen returning home from the new buildings.

A group of these came swaying along arm in arm, singing a lewd song at the pitch of their voices.
Andrea stopped to let them pass.
